Yes they are good. Search button will give all the answers, as covered loads before. General thought is the 170bhp is worse with DMF issues but a delete solves that. Quite tuneable and again search says 200+ is possible With the 130bhp easy achieving the 170 mark on a map.

Read common issues with the mk5 in general. Hope that helps.
